Verdence Capital Advisors LLC Increases Stock Position in Synchrony Financial (NYSE:SYF)

Verdence Capital Advisors LLC increased its holdings in shares of Synchrony Financial (NYSE:SYFFree Report) by 4.1%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 28,044 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after purchasing an additional 1,114 shares during the period. Verdence Capital Advisors LLC’s holdings in Synchrony Financial were worth $1,071,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Synchrony Financial Price Performance

Shares of NYSE:SYF opened at $41.57 on Monday. The firm’s 50 day moving average is $41.22 and its two-hundred day moving average is $36.45. Synchrony Financial has a 52 week low of $26.59 and a 52 week high of $43.83. The firm has a market capitalization of $16.91 billion, a P/E ratio of 8.03, a PEG ratio of 1.03 and a beta of 1.61. The company has a current ratio of 1.22, a quick ratio of 1.22 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.21.

Synchrony Financial (NYSE:SYFG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, January 23rd. The financial services provider reported $1.03 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.93 by $0.10. The company had revenue of $5.55 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.45 billion. Synchrony Financial had a net margin of 10.68% and a return on equity of 17.37%. During the same quarter last year, the business earned $1.26 earnings per share. Analysts anticipate that Synchrony Financial will post 5.54 earnings per share for the current year.

Synchrony Financial Announces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, February 15th. Stockholders of record on Monday, February 5th were issued a $0.25 dividend. This represents a $1.00 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.41%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, February 2nd. Synchrony Financial’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 19.31%.

About Synchrony Financial

(Free Report)

Synchrony Financial,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a consumer financial services company in the United States. It provides credit products, such as credit cards, commercial credit products, and consumer installment loans. The company also offers private label credit cards, dual co-brand and general purpose credit cards, short- and long-term installment loans, and consumer banking products; and deposit products, including certificates of deposit, individual retirement accounts, money market accounts, and savings accounts, and sweep and affinity deposits, as well as accepts deposits through third-party securities brokerage firms.
